Common Indicators of Wetness in a Structure
Moisture issues within a building can materialize with several recognizable indications that suggest the visibility of wetness. One noticeable indication is the appearance of water stains on walls or ceilings, which usually indicates wetness seepage. Furthermore, gurgling or peeling paint can suggest that excess moisture is caught under the surface area, resulting in degeneration. Another typical indication is the existence of mold and mold, which prosper in damp problems and can often be recognized by their stuffy odor. In addition, a surge in humidity degrees can trigger condensation on windows and various other surfaces, highlighting wetness troubles. Ultimately, unequal or deformed flooring might indicate underlying wetness that endangers architectural honesty. Identifying these indicators early can assist minimize potential damages and maintain a risk-free living atmosphere. Normal inspections and punctual action are important in dealing with wetness issues prior to they escalate.

Different Sorts Of Damp Proofing Solutions
Although different elements can add to damp issues in buildings, choosing the ideal moist proofing option is vital for protecting structural integrity. Several options are readily available, each customized to details conditions.One typical solution is a damp-proof membrane (DPM), normally made from polyethylene or asphalt, which is mounted in wall surfaces and floorings to stop wetness ingress. An additional option is damp-proof programs (DPC), which are layers of water resistant product positioned within wall surfaces to block climbing damp.Chemical damp proofing entails injecting waterproofing chemicals into walls to produce an obstacle against moisture. Additionally, outside therapies such as tanking, which entails applying a water resistant layer to the beyond structures, can be efficient in preventing water penetration.Each option has its advantages and is chosen based on the structure's specific issues, environmental problems, and long-lasting upkeep factors to consider, making certain ideal defense versus damp-related damages.

Choosing the Right Damp Proofing Method for Your Property
Which damp proofing technique is most suitable for a specific residential or commercial property typically relies on numerous aspects, including the building's age, existing dampness problems, and local environmental problems. For older frameworks, standard approaches such as bitumen membrane layers or cementitious coverings might be more effective, as they can supply a robust obstacle versus rising moist. In comparison, newer structures might benefit from modern services like infused damp-proof training courses, which are much less invasive and can be tailored to certain moisture challenges.Additionally, homes in locations with high water tables or hefty rains may require advanced methods, such as dental caries wall drain systems or exterior waterproofing. Property owners must likewise take into consideration the particular products made use of in their building's construction, as some methods may not be compatible. Inevitably, a comprehensive analysis by an expert can direct residential property owners in picking one of the most reliable damp proofing method tailored to their special situations.
